(Sportsbook Betting Lines) - The fist-place Minnesota Wild will try to avoid their first three-game losing streak of the season when they host the lowly New York Islanders for this evening's clash at Xcel Energy Center. The Wild, who are leading the Northwest Division and are tied for the top spot in the Western Conference with 44 points, dropped consecutive games on back- to-back nights this week.
Matt Cullen, Mikko Koivu and Kyle Brodziak all had goals for the Wild, who haven't dropped three in a row since April 2-7 of last season.
Wild goaltender Josh Harding has been activated from injured reserve and will at least serve as Backstrom's backup tonight. Harding, who is 7-2-1 with a 2.14 goals-against average on the season, last played on Dec. 6 when he suffered a neck injury in San Jose. Rookie Matt Hackett had been serving as Minnesota's second goaltender, but was sent back to Houston of the AHL to make room for Harding.
The Islanders are last in the Eastern Conference with 24 points and enter tonight on a four-game losing streak. New York is also just 3-6-3 as the visiting team this year and is kicking off a three-game road trip tonight.
New York's most recent setback came Thursday against visiting Dallas, as Brenden Morrow and Jamie Benn scored early in the third period to help lift the Stars to a 3-2 decision at Nassau Coliseum.
Isles forward Brian Rolston and defenseman Steve Staios will both miss tonight's game with concussions.
New York posted a 2-1 home win over the Wild on Oct. 10 and has won two straight in this series after losing the previous five encounters. Minnesota has won three straight and five of the six all-time meetings in St. Paul.
